1.
WHAT NEXIAM CONTAINS:
Each sachet of NEXIAM 2,5 mg contains 2,5 mg esomeprazole (as
magnesium trihydrate).
1.3.2 Page 3 of 10
Each sachet of NEXIAM 5 mg contains 5 mg esomeprazole (as
magnesium trihydrate).
_The other ingredients in NEXIAM 2,5 and 5 mg Sachets are:_
glycerol monostearate, hyprolose, hypromellose, magnesium stearate,
methacrylic acid copolymer, polysorbate 80, sugar spheres, talc,
triethyl
citrate, dextrose, xanthan gum, crospovidone, citric acid, iron oxide
(yellow)
(E 172), hyprolose. Contains sugar (sucrose).
2.
WHAT NEXIAM IS USED FOR:
NEXIAM is a type of medicine called a “proton pump inhibitor”
(medicines
used to treat ulcers). It reduces the production of acid in your
stomach.
NEXIAM is used for treating the following conditions:
•
the decrease in acidity in the food pipe by reducing the acidity of
the return flow fluid
from the stomach in neonates and infants.
•
the treatment of Gastro Oesophageal Reflux Disease (GORD) i.e. a
condition caused by
a return flow of fluid from the stomach into the food pipe confirmed
by special a test
(pH probe or endoscopy).

PHARMACOLOGICAL CLASSIFICATION:
A 11.4.3 Medicines acting on gastro-intestinal tract. Other.
PHARMACOLOGICAL ACTION:
_Pharmacodynamic properties: _
Esomeprazole, the S-isomer of omeprazole, reduces gastric acid
secretion through specific
inhibition of the acid pump in the parietal cell, where it is
concentrated and converted to the
active form in the acidic environment of the secretory canaliculi and
inhibits the enzyme
H
+
K
+
-ATPase – the acid pump. This effect on the final step of the
gastric acid secretion is
dose-dependent and provides for effective inhibition of both basal and
stimulated acid
secretion.
_Effect on gastric acid secretion: _
After oral dosing with esomeprazole 20 mg and 40 mg the onset of
effect occurs within 1
hour. After repeated administration with 20 mg esomeprazole once daily
for 5 days, mean
peak acid output after pentagastrin stimulation is decreased by 90 %
when measured 6-7
hours after dosing on day 5.
